Markovian structure in the concave majorant of Brownian motion

Abstract

The purpose of this paper is to highlight some hidden Markovian structure of the concave majorant of the Brownian motion. Several distributional identities are implied by the joint law of a standard one-dimensional Brownian motion BB and its almost surely unique concave majorant KK on [0,)[0,\infty). In particular, the one-dimensional distribution of 2KtBt2 K_t - B_t is that of R5(t)R_5(t), where R5R_5 is a 55-dimensional Bessel process with R5(0)=0R_5(0) = 0. The process 2KB2K-B shares a number of other properties with R5R_5, and we conjecture that it may have the distribution of R5R_5. We also describe the distribution of the convex minorant of a three-dimensional Bessel process with drift.
